Oct 19, 2019 go to baking, and select normal scroll down and select selected to active. You can bake a normal map from an high resolution mesh to an low poly mesh using the transfer maps feature of maya. Go to baking, and select normal scroll down and select selected to active. Where ever that ray intersects the high poly mesh, it will sample the normals from it. It wants to bake the information to an existing texture map. May 16, 2014 many artists want to read the normal map bake with its normal settings to understand and see where eventually issues are. Using a cage is a great way to get a highquality normal map, regardless of the surface that you are baking. They can make a drab object interact with light in a believable way. If your low poly still has bevels instead, it may not be so important.
This program can bake texture maps from 3d models from a high poly to low poly. When baking a normal map from highpoly mesh to lowpoly, several conditions have to be taken into account assuming lowpoly is already unwrapped. Textures can simulate highresolution details very believably but without the highpolygon counts. Bake a wide variety of map types tangent space and object space normal maps at the same time. Thanks to pablo perez for creating the high polygon tire. Shadermap normal map generator create rendering and pbr. Optional if your object will be deforming, like a character, ensure that coordinate system in outputs advanced settings normal map is set to tangent space. While quixel has recently added certain baking it doesnt do it for highpoly to lowpoly and as such the major use of the two programs are far from similar. However, there are many aspects that were fairly straightforward in blender that are downright infuriating to get through in maya. Product manager, technical artist and documentation at adobe. Bake the high poly normals on to the low poly object. License information will be sent to your email address immediately after payment is received usually within 510 minutes but can take up to 48 hours. Yes, the cage should be the same polycount as it must have the same face.
Bake normal maps from meshes blenders default render engine, blender render or blender internal as its often called, includes a dedicated subsystem that can be used to generate various types of image map, typically of an object in of itself direct or selfreferencing, or by translating the details of one to another indirect or. As the title says, what is the best overall software, to bake normal maps and more with. Common xnormal baking errors and how to solve them. For human characters, yeah, it not likely to be so useful. Load a 3d model into the project grid and render normal maps, ao, curve, color id, and depth from the model geometry. A normal map is commonly used to fake highresolution details on a lowresolution model. Now if youre unsure of what a normal map is, you should take a look at this video to help clarify. With the ability to bake tangent space normal1, object space normal, tangent. Outputs maps in 16bits per channel for more precision and less banding. They can make a simple model look beautiful and complex.
Map baking extracting geometric data from a 3d object to a 2d texture. Problem baking normal maps with transfer maps after a long session of fiddling with the most of the mesh display tools and manually tuning some vertex normals, im getting closer to my desired output. The purpose of a cage is to modify the direction that the rays are traced, which is derived from normals. Mikktspace has been fully integrated into knald, ensuring the normal maps. Then, click your high poly mesh and shift click your low poly mesh, and then bake it. The tangent space is a vector space which is tangent to the models surface. Substance seems like it could be super handy by having baking right in your texturing software, and the objectname sensitive baking seems like it could also be. This way you get the details of the dense high poly mesh in a much more optimized form that can be used in real time in the game using the baked maps like the normal map and the ambient occlusion maps for example the texturing can. In the outputs shader outputs settings, disable full shading and enable normal map. Texture painting using blenders painting system to paint directly on your 3d model in the viewport. Forgot to add, this is for generating normal maps for heightmap based terrain, so even though its already in meshes form, planar mapping is ok as all meshes are strictly planar and displaced over a single axis. The coordinate system varies smoothly based on the derivatives of position with respect to texture coordinates across the surface. How to bake a normal map software tips wonderhowto.
This is the workflow i use when baking maps for my game ready meshes. Most normal map baking tools allow you to use a distancebased raycast. Best programs for making height maps, normal maps, andor other maps. The red, green, and blue channels of the image are used to control the direction of each pixels normal. So when we bake a normal map, blender doesnt create the texture map as part of the process. The normal map would be calculated from a high poly model 100m, mapped on a simplified low poly model 2. Handplane baker processes extremely dense models easily. Select a mode and source type then load the source file shadermap will create a project generating maps from the source. Decimeting your zbrush sculpts takes longer than simply exporting and baking. Njob is a simple tool that supports a number of filters related to normalmapping and texture creation.
Mightybake a powerful, yet easy to use, allinone texture. Having said this there are alternative techniques available that generate equally valid normal maps. Baking normal maps using cage projection step a in this section we will be baking high polygon normals from the source model onto a low polygon cage model. Normal map creation in maya valve developer community. Reversing the y in xnormal makes it hard to understand. Download windows and linux sourcecode licensed gplv3 current screenshot. However, you can make one from copying your low polygon model and then increasing its. Now as we have mentioned in previous videos here we have our textureset list, which again. Recommended software for baking normalsambient occlusion. Problem baking normal maps with transfer maps autodesk.
So within painter, we have an integrated baking system, and so here that baking system is going to be found within the textureset settings, and youll notice that here we have this bake textures option. Even after baking the normal maps to a low poly version it still looks great. It would be great to have builtin normal map baking. The info of the high poly mesh is baked into 2d texture maps that can be used on the low poly mesh. Many artists want to read the normal map bake with its normal settings to understand and see where eventually issues are. Download complete project here download free materials here. Instructor in this video, were going to do an overview of how the substance painter bakers work. No fancy cluttered skins and other things, shortcuts for all key functions. Bake normal maps with turtle maya lt 2016 autodesk.
The exact orientation of tangent space vectors is therefore of vital importance both during baking when a normal map is created, and rendering when a normal map is used. Diffuse displacement normal ao specular environment if you like this, please need a texture. Also, the main 3d software packages and the dedicated 3d sculpting software each usually have their own integrated normal map creation tools. That is mostly due to the slew of features, and slightly confusing. So the second way is to bake it out normally from xnormal and then once everything is ok, to go to the green channel in photoshop and reverse it manually. Supports maps up to 8192 x 8192 resolution for ultra high quality results. Quixel suite was made to texture 3d objects, while xnormal was made to bake high poly models into lowpoly textures. Mightybake lets you pick your target game engine and it will take care of all the details so you can use your map without the need for any post processing or having to load it in a second application to fix the tangent basis. Having a single smoothing group across the entire low poly asset and having all the uvs connected means that during rendering of the normal map xnormal has to conform the high poly details, meaning it has to compensate during the bake because the normal directions are often offset from the low poly compared to the high poly since it has less. The hack in this hack, you will be using your normal map to get an ambient occlusion for details that dont actually exist on your model. The result of the normal map bake is a flat black map. And in addition, we need a texture, a premade texture to back to.
Baking high to low poly maps in substance painter full workflow duration. What are the best programs for making height maps, normal maps, andor. Most normal mapping software can make your cage automatically. Baking normal maps on the gpu diogo teixeira move interactive ever since normal mapping heidrich and seidel 1999 became a standard technique in modern realtime rendering, it has raised productivity issues for artists as they strive to meet the demands of higher visual standards within their usual time constraints. Hi, since i was unhappy with the normalmap generators i tried like gimp normalmap plugin or nvidia photoshop plugin i started to write my own several months ago. We need to pull that down and choose normal map so lets choose that. Modify the high poly object to prepare it for baking. Learn how to bake a normal map mesh to mesh using highres meshes targeted to a low res mesh in modo 301. It supports normal, spec and displacementmaps, stack processing of multiple images and it is completely multithreaded. Bake normal maps from meshes using blender render internal.
Take a look at how you can bake normals onto a low resolution model using a high resolution model, within. Tips for creating perfect normal maps every time pluralsight. Normal map baking does not reflect details blender stack. It can be exported from the help menu of the software. A normal map is an image that stores a direction at each pixel. A ray is sent outwards along each vertex normal, then at the distance you set a ray is cast back inwards.
Mistreating any one of these components can lead to ugly, normal maps and wasted time. If you simply want to create a normal map out of a texture, we suggest you using crazybump or any other normal map creation tool like nvidias normal tool for this task. Guest apr 2016 0 agrees and 1 disagrees disagree agree. Marmoset toolbag 3 3d rendering, lookdev, and production tools. All in a fraction of the time of other baking software. Marmoset toolbag 3 3d rendering, lookdev, and production. Normal map reuse is made possible by encoding maps in tangent space. Christian petry, fliederweg 6, 91094 langensendelbach, germany enviroment map from humus. Dec 19, 2012 i explain three essential concepts for baking normal maps from a high resolution mesh to a low resolution mesh. The polycount page i linked has lots of tips for getting good results from normal bakes, it does mention max a lot, but for the most part is appropriate for any software. Modify the low poly object and unwrap its uvs to prepare it for baking. This quick 3d modeling software tutorial explains how to bake a normal map in modo 301. The majority of our texture outputs use very fast non conventional aproaches that allow for quick and clean results.
Texturing plays a powerful role in computer graphics, but especially for game asset creation. Generating perfect normal maps for unity and other programs. Apr 18, 2017 normal maps contain rgb values that correspond to xyz coordinates within this space. Normal maps contain rgb values that correspond to xyz coordinates within this space. Open the texture baking view window windows materialtexture baking editors texture baking view. Ambient occlusion and normal map bake using xnormal. Which is the software that i used to use before painter and designer. The first few times using the software, you may have a hard time getting what you want. In this tutorial you will learn how to bake flawless normal maps for game or for film purpose using blender 2. What kaspar says, keep having problems with baking normals, good to see someone. Guest dec 2017 5 agrees and 0 disagrees disagree agree. The highly anticipated third version of marmoset toolbag is now available for mac and windows. I myself use 3dsmax, but the bakes are not of a quality i.
919 306 174 1319 1090 320 1426 1140 690 276 1307 1294 1481 130 379 189 1347 883 755 957 1098 1576 699 1443 655 1087 1439 706 1404 246 1067 1357 1046 821 281 151 1223 130 521 734 148 228 130